According to the central place theory, a city contains more than one center around which activities revolve.
LiRa [457]

Answer:

False

Explanation:

Among the most famous models of location of economic activities is the one that Walter Christaller developed to explain how they are distributed and how they are organized. The theory is called "of the central places" because it assumes that there services are provided people approach to obtain it. In this way a point appears in the space that organizes the territory around itself. Thus, a central place is one that offers services, and to which the population goes to satisfy it.

The services offered by a <u>central point</u> are those demanded by society, regardless of their nature. But not all services have the same price, nor does the population have the same need to travel to obtain them, nor is it willing to go anywhere it is offered. There is a logic of economic behavior that governs the emergence of services and their chances of success.
